The Wizard World Chapter 288

"Green, what about you?" Hikari looked at Angele curiously. "Your potion concocting skills are better than mine. You can come join the institute if you want."

Angele shook his head. "I got my hands on one Elemental Hand badge. I’ll be heading to its location soon."

"Elemental Hand…Good choice! It’s one of the three strongest wizard organizations in the Tarry River area. Green, you’re a strong and talented wizard. Your future is bright." Hikari nodded. "We should keep in touch. We have come from the same place and we have survived all the challenges together. I’ll be there if you need my help."

"That’s why we’re here. We all have our own goals. I’m sure we’ll succeed in future. We should contact each other when necessary and help each other improve." Stigma smiled.

Reyline and Angele nodded their heads without saying anything.

"But…" Hikari hesitated for a second. "Do any of you know what happened to Morrisa? Why isn’t she here?"

"I know." Reyline opened his mouth. "She went to a remote area and was injured severely when she returned to the city. Her mentality level decreased a lot…and she spent a long time recovering in her home. I have heard that she’s getting married to a random wizard. I asked her to come to the meeting, but she declined my invitation."

The three wizards were surprised upon listening to him.

"Maybe it’s a better choice for her." Hikari stared at Angele and Stigma. "Even if she was not injured, she would not be able to advance to the next rank anytime soon and you two, I’m not going to ask what exactly happened in the White Mist Town."

Hikari knew that something happened to Stigma and Angele after leaving the White Mist Town. Stigma’s mentality level was increasing exponentially, and he was now much more confident than before.

Stigma remained silent for several seconds and asked, "When is Morrisa’s wedding?"

"Next week," Reyline responded in a light tone. "She invited us to attend the wedding as we’re still friends, but she doesn’t want us to talk too much with her fiancé. Morrisa lied about her actual situation. I think we should help her keep this secret."

"So we’re going, right?" Hikari wondered.

Angele and Stigma nodded their heads.

"Also, Stigma, just let us know if you need help with your family issues. We are friends. I’ll see what I can do," Hikari added in a light tone.

"Yeah." Reyline nodded slightly.

"Yeah, just talk to us." Angele looked at Stigma.

"Thank you. I’ll contact you when I really need your help." Stigma shook his head. "The strongest wizards in my family are the family head, my father, and the elders. They’re all rank 2 wizards. I’ll wait until I advance to rank 2." It seemed rank 2 wizards were not a big deal to him. "Alright, I need to leave now. Otherwise, my sister will be angry. We can contact each other through the signal obelisk."

"Sure."

Angele responded in a light tone.

"I’ll invite you to my family’s territory when the time comes." Stigma stood up chuckling, then left the café.

The three wizards knew that Stigma was going to take the leader’s position by force in the future and they decided to help.

"I’ll be leaving too." Hikari stood up. "The members of my guild are still…" A green light dot flashed on the back of her right hand before she could finish speaking.

Hikari shrugged. "Well, they’re sending me messages again." She tapped on the back of her glowing nail.

The message was transmitted to the three wizards’ ears through the energy particles.

"Master Hikari, where are you? We need to prepare for the testing phase of the potion. Please report back immediately. Otherwise, wizard Marian will question us again…"

Angele and Reyline chuckled after listening to the message.

"See, I’m not lying. The leader of the division is giving me a lot of pressure on the project I’m working on. I’m super busy nowadays." Hikari shook her head.

"Alright, don’t make them wait. I still want to talk to Reyline." Angele smiled.

"Master Hikari, are you talking with your friends? I apologize if I interrupted your conversation! I’m sorry!" Another message was sent to Hikari’s communication rune.

"I’m done. I’ll be there soon. Just stay at where you are right now," Hikari responded quickly.

She deactivated the communication rune and waved at the two male wizards that were still in their seats.

"See you later."

"Bye."

"Bye. Talk to you later."

Reyline and Angele said goodbye to Hikari.

They watched Hikari leave the café and disappear around the corner.

Angele and Reyline were the only two wizards left on the table.

Hikari’s glowing communication rune caught the attention of the customers and the owner. There were several teenagers staring at them and guessing who they were.

The place had now become rowdy as people were all chatting about what had just happened.

The owner of the shop was a bald old man. He asked two pretty waitresses to check on the two mysterious customers by the window.

"Masters, do you need something else?" The waitress on the left was around 18 years old and the one on the right was around 20 years old. They were wearing white short skirts and their voices were sweet. The two girls were young and attractive.

"Two cups of green tea." Reyline put down a silver coin which was engraved with an image of a long-haired old man.

The rough edge of the silver coin reflected the sunlight.

"Sure, I’ll bring the tea to you soon." The two waitresses picked up the two coins and returned to the counter, looking excited.

The other waiters and waitresses walked to the two girls and started asking questions. Their conversation made the place even noisier.

"Interesting. I thought wizards were not rare here…" Angele grabbed the cup and sipped some fruit coffee. It was sweet and sour; the aftertaste was a bit bitter.

"The coffee is a bit too sour for me." He put down the cup.

"Why did you choose Elemental Hand? That organization is not good enough for you. You should’ve chosen a larger one." Reyline looked at Angele.

"I made an agreement with someone." Angele pursed his lips. "Do you think we’ll all make it to rank 2?"

"The chances are high, I believe," Reyline responded quickly.

"I was thinking if we meet again after 50 years, will we still be the same people we are right now?" Angele pursed his lips into a smile.

"Hikari and I won’t change. I’m not sure about you and Stigma." Reyline leaned to the window and looked outside. "Just like Morrisa, no one can predict the future. We can only keep progressing and hope for the best."

"Can’t you be positive for once?" Angele shook his head. "Stigma will advance to rank 2 with no problem. Don’t ask me why. I just know."

"You’ll advance to rank 2 too." Reyline eyed Angele. "Everyone has their own secrets. You, me, Hikari, and Stigma all have secrets. Advancing to rank 2 and acquiring an advanced meditation technique should be my priority. A rank 2 wizard will be respected by the majority of large organizations in the central continent I believe."

"I understand. How’s your progression?" Angele nodded.

"I’m still preparing for the next step. I’m looking for a special energy circle that will help me advance to the next rank. I have decided to accept missions from the society and trade for the resources I need," Reyline responded in a low voice.

Angele did not say anything. He had checked with Henn before he came to the shop and he knew that Reyline was walking the same path as the other wizards. Reyline needed many resources to help him increase the mentality level so he could advance to the next rank.

That was what most of the wizards would do.

The wizards in other areas relied solely on the rare resources but the wizards in the central continent had clear directions and Reyline might have already found what he needed.

"Do you know which advanced meditation technique is the best for you? The Wizards’ Society is strong, but I don’t think they’ll give you the best technique they have." Angele inquired.

"I know what I should do but I need to finish all the challenges given by the society first. It will take me a while."

"You should be fine. Just think twice before you make any important decision." Angele knew that Reyline was talented. He was called the Perfect Wizard of the younger generation in Six Ring High Tower and an advanced meditation technique would help him to reach a whole different level.

They left the café together after finishing their conversation.

*************************

"Where’s my brother?"

Inside a white manor outside the city, a tired-looking girl wearing a red leather suit walked into the study. There was a complicated v-shaped pattern between her eyebrows.

The girl’s long black hair trailed over her shoulders. She held an emerald-tipped white wand in her right hand.

There was another pretty girl standing beside the bookshelf reading a thick book with golden edges on the cover. She was wearing a white silk shirt and a pair of tight blue jeans.

"Stigma is not here. He will study after he comes back." The girl in a white shirt shrugged.

"He’s never liked studying and meditating when he was young…but he’s a grown-up man now." The girl in red rubbed her temples and sighed. "He’ll never break the limit if he doesn’t put more time into it. I need to punish him when he comes back!"

Chapter end
